France is entering Eurovision 2025 in Basel in style, as always. This year, they are represented by Louane, an artist who is already a big name, competing with the impressive ballad “Maman.”
Since 2023, France has returned to internal selections, and Louane was chosen through this process as well. The announcement of her participation sparked excitement among Eurovision fans.
When it comes to Eurovision, France has a strong history of victories. The country has won five times: in 1958 with André Claveau, in 1960 with Jacqueline Boyer, in 1962 with Isabelle Aubret, in 1969 with Frida Boccara (in a rare four-way tie), and in 1977 with Marie Myriam. It’s been a long time since their last win—could this be the year France brings home its sixth trophy?
France at Eurovision 2025: 10 Facts about Louane
1. She is from Sainte-Catherine
Louane, whose full stage name is Louane Emera, comes from a small commune called Saint-Catherine in the Pas-de-Calais region. She was born under the name Anne Edwige Maria Peichert on November 26, 1996.
2. She is a former The Voice contestant
Louane was a semi-finalist in the 2013 edition of The Voice: la plus belle voix. Her participation in the show impressed the audience and helped her build a name in the music industry.
3. Besides music, she is a well-known actress too
Even though music is her first passion, Louane is also an actress and is well-known for her acting. She gained popularity by playing the lead role in the French-Belgian coming-of-age comedy film La Famille Bélier. Her performance in the film earned her recognition, and in 2024, she received the César Award for Most Promising Actress. In the movie, she portrayed a 16-year-old girl who is the only hearing person in a family of deaf people, and she also sings in the film. Besides this, Louane has taken on other roles, including a leading role in the mystery series Visions.
4. She is a proud mother
Louane is together with fellow singer Florian Rossi, and they have a little girl, Esmée . Her Eurovision song, “Maman,” creates a bridge between Louane, her daughter, and her late mother, whom she lost when she was a teenager. The song expresses an open letter filled with longing and honors her mother, while also reflecting on how special the experience of motherhood feels to her.
5. Louane roots are complex
Louane lost both her parents when she was a teenager. Despite this, she was left with a complex heritage that she is very proud of. Louane’s father, Jean-Pierre Peichert, was French, the son of a Polish mother and a German father. Her mother, Isabel Pinto dos Santos, was Brazilian-Portuguese, the daughter of a Portuguese father and a Brazilian mother.
6. She opened for Jessie J
One of the impressive achievements in Louane’s early career was when, back in 2015, she opened for the famous British superstar Jessie J during her showcase in Paris.
7. She doubles voices for animated movies
In addition to her acting career, Louane has also lent her voice for animated movies. You can hear her voice in the French versions of Trolls, Sahara, and Incredibles 2.
8. She has many siblings
Louane comes from a big family, she has four sisters and one brother.
9. She has ADHD
Louane was diagnosed with ADHD when she was 8 years old, and she struggled with hyperactivity during her childhood. However, over time, she has learned a lot about self-discipline and how to manage it.
10. She collaborated with The Chainsmokers
Louane has a collaboration with the famous American electronic duo The Chainsmokers on their debut album, Memories… Do Not Open. She provides vocals for the track “It Won’t Kill Ya.”
